Final Show! 50/50: Ayckbourn & CTG
Written by admin on September 19, 2009 – 8:09 am -Trace the remarkable 50 year writing career of Sir Alan Ayckbourn while re-living scenes from the dozen Ayckbourn plays that have been produced by Chester Theatre Group (also celebrating their 50th year), including four American premieres! Members of the CTG original casts reassemble for a memorable evening, including a piece of Ayckbourn writing never heard on any American stage!
Scenes from THE NORMAN CONQUESTS, ABSURD PERSON SINGULAR, BEDROOM FARCE, RELATIVELY SPEAKING, WOMAN IN MIND, FAMILY CIRCLES, TIME OF MY LIFE, BODY LANGUAGE, SNAKE IN THE GRASS, and IMPROBALE FICTION!

CTG Scores Eight Perry Noms!
Written by admin on August 4, 2009 – 11:00 pm -Once again, CTG has been honored by New Jersey Association of Community Theatres with nominations in major categories in the 2009 Perry Awards.
Our production of On Golden Pond is nominated in 7 categories, including Outstanding Production of a Play.
Our production of Home for the Holidays is nominated as Outstanding Production of an Original Musical.
Congratulations to all nominees! The awards dinner will be held September 20, 2009 at the DoubleTree in Somerset.
